The Grade II-listed Victorian shopping arcade, has been derelict since 2016

It is hoped there will be a bar, restaurant or coffee shop at either end, turning the derelict site into a leisure attraction at the heart of the market town.Once completed, the intention is to lease the building to a community benefit society, Arcade Group Dewsbury Ltd, run as a not-for-profit venture with the interests of the town at its heart.

Chris Hill, development director at the Arcade Group Dewsbury, said: “The restoration of any listed building is complex and painstaking and there have inevitably been delays along the way. Mr Hill added: “The Arcade will be England’s first community-run shopping centre and this is a unique opportunity for everybody in Dewsbury to get involved and have a stake in the town’s future prosperity.Of course, there’s a long way to go but we want people to come along to the meeting next week to find out how they can be in at the start of something that will really put Dewsbury back on the national map.

The Arcade Group Dewsbury has already had around 25 people express an interest in taking space when the restoration is complete.People can just turn up on the day or register ahead of the event https://www.eventbrite.co.uk/e/dewsbury-arcade-action-programme-launch-tickets-375916495357Last year an internal strip-out was completed leaving “something of a blank canvas to work with”.
